The residency
allows SPARX to pursue a cherished mission: to inspire
young people to become life-long listeners of concert
music. SPARX performs for several all-school functions
such as May Day and Founder’s Day. They accompany
the Lower School Holiday Concert and the Pre School
Tree Trim. Several times a year, the duo performs for
Lower School Opening Exercises. The Middle School employs
SPARX to collaborate in poetry readings, story telling,
and the annual 6th Grade Naming Ceremony. Frequent classroom visitors, SPARX has assisted Upper School Math
Department chair, Martha Lowther in her Math and Music
unit. SPARX can be heard weekly in the Lower School
building as they rehearse for concerts in the school
and the community at large. Tatnall is the site for
the popular SPARX Candlelight Cabaret Series, and the
school’s new performing arts center will be the
new home of the SPARX chamber music series in 2008. |
